Home
last modified time | relevance | path

Searched refs:driver_find (Results 1 - 21 of 21) sorted by relevance

/kernel/linux/linux-6.6/drivers/dma/idxd/
H A Dcompat.c47 alt_drv = driver_find("idxd", bus); in bind_store()
52 alt_drv = driver_find("dmaengine", bus); in bind_store()
54 alt_drv = driver_find("user", bus); in bind_store()
/kernel/linux/linux-5.10/drivers/base/
H A Ddriver.c233 other = driver_find(drv->name, drv->bus); in driver_register()
272 * driver_find - locate driver on a bus by its name.
283 struct device_driver *driver_find(const char *name, struct bus_type *bus) in driver_find() function
296 EXPORT_SYMBOL_GPL(driver_find); variable
/kernel/linux/linux-5.10/drivers/media/pci/cx18/
H A Dcx18-alsa-main.c272 drv = driver_find("cx18", &pci_bus_type); in cx18_alsa_exit()
/kernel/linux/linux-5.10/drivers/media/pci/ivtv/
H A Divtv-alsa-main.c272 drv = driver_find("ivtv", &pci_bus_type); in ivtv_alsa_exit()
H A Divtvfb.c1281 drv = driver_find("ivtv", &pci_bus_type); in ivtvfb_init()
1298 drv = driver_find("ivtv", &pci_bus_type); in ivtvfb_cleanup()
/kernel/linux/linux-5.10/drivers/s390/net/
H A Dsmsgiucv_app.c163 smsgiucv_drv = driver_find(SMSGIUCV_DRV_NAME, &iucv_bus); in smsgiucv_app_init()
/kernel/linux/linux-5.10/include/linux/device/
H A Ddriver.h127 extern struct device_driver *driver_find(const char *name,
/kernel/linux/linux-6.6/drivers/base/
H A Ddriver.c239 other = driver_find(drv->name, drv->bus); in driver_register()
H A Dbus.c1299 * driver_find - locate driver on a bus by its name.
1310 struct device_driver *driver_find(const char *name, const struct bus_type *bus) in driver_find() function
1330 EXPORT_SYMBOL_GPL(driver_find); variable
/kernel/linux/linux-6.6/include/linux/device/
H A Ddriver.h128 struct device_driver *driver_find(const char *name, const struct bus_type *bus);
/kernel/linux/linux-6.6/drivers/media/pci/cx18/
H A Dcx18-alsa-main.c265 drv = driver_find("cx18", &pci_bus_type); in cx18_alsa_exit()
/kernel/linux/linux-6.6/drivers/media/pci/ivtv/
H A Divtv-alsa-main.c265 drv = driver_find("ivtv", &pci_bus_type); in ivtv_alsa_exit()
H A Divtvfb.c1280 drv = driver_find("ivtv", &pci_bus_type); in ivtvfb_init()
1297 drv = driver_find("ivtv", &pci_bus_type); in ivtvfb_cleanup()
/kernel/linux/linux-6.6/drivers/s390/net/
H A Dsmsgiucv_app.c163 smsgiucv_drv = driver_find(SMSGIUCV_DRV_NAME, &iucv_bus); in smsgiucv_app_init()
/kernel/linux/linux-5.10/drivers/media/pci/cx25821/
H A Dcx25821-alsa.c787 struct device_driver *drv = driver_find("cx25821", &pci_bus_type); in cx25821_audio_fini()
813 struct device_driver *drv = driver_find("cx25821", &pci_bus_type); in cx25821_alsa_init()
/kernel/linux/linux-6.6/drivers/media/pci/cx25821/
H A Dcx25821-alsa.c786 struct device_driver *drv = driver_find("cx25821", &pci_bus_type); in cx25821_audio_fini()
812 struct device_driver *drv = driver_find("cx25821", &pci_bus_type); in cx25821_alsa_init()
/kernel/linux/linux-5.10/drivers/input/gameport/
H A Dgameport.c483 } else if ((drv = driver_find(buf, &gameport_bus)) != NULL) { in drvctl_store()
/kernel/linux/linux-6.6/drivers/input/gameport/
H A Dgameport.c482 } else if ((drv = driver_find(buf, &gameport_bus)) != NULL) { in drvctl_store()
/kernel/linux/linux-5.10/drivers/input/serio/
H A Dserio.c400 } else if ((drv = driver_find(buf, &serio_bus)) != NULL) { in drvctl_store()
/kernel/linux/linux-6.6/drivers/ata/pata_parport/
H A Dpata_parport.c657 drv = driver_find(protocol, &pata_parport_bus_type); in new_device_store()
/kernel/linux/linux-6.6/drivers/input/serio/
H A Dserio.c397 } else if ((drv = driver_find(buf, &serio_bus)) != NULL) { in drvctl_store()

Completed in 20 milliseconds